+namespace Symfony\Component\Security\Acl\Model;
+
+/**
+ * Provides support for creating and storing ACL instances.
+ *
+ * @author Johannes M. Schmitt <schmittjoh@gmail.com>
+ */
+interface MutableAclProviderInterface extends AclProviderInterface
+{
+    /**
+     * Creates a new ACL for the given object identity.
+     *
+     * @throws AclAlreadyExistsException when there already is an ACL for the given
+     *                                   object identity
+     * @param ObjectIdentityInterface $oid
+     * @return AclInterface
+     */
+    function createAcl(ObjectIdentityInterface $oid);
+
+    /**
+     * Deletes the ACL for a given object identity.
+     *
+     * This will automatically trigger a delete for any child ACLs. If you don't
+     * want child ACLs to be deleted, you will have to set their parent ACL to null.
+     *
+     * @param ObjectIdentityInterface $oid
+     * @return void
+     */
+    function deleteAcl(ObjectIdentityInterface $oid);
+
+    /**
+     * Persists any changes which were made to the ACL, or any associated
+     * access control entries.
+     *
+     * Changes to parent ACLs are not persisted.
+     *
+     * @param MutableAclInterface $acl
+     * @return void
+     */
+    function updateAcl(MutableAclInterface $acl);
+}
